    I'll show you how to make a classic, authentic French pastry cream, known as crème pâtissière.
    This was one of the first things we learned in pastry school way way back. This pastry cream is found in many French desserts, such as chocolate eclairs, tartes au flans, including fruit flan ( fruit tart ) milles feuilles ( a direct translation meaning "thousand leaves" because we use a puff pastry, and it has so many layers or "feuilles".

    Hi duckieboo, yes, all pastry creams are custards, however are different depending on the amount of eggs vs cream or milk used and how thick or thin the final product is. For example crème anglaise is another custard based cream, but is super thin, but technically it's also a custard, because it is derived from the same ingredients.     Hi again tgchism if you want to put chocolate into a croissant, that can be done just before baking. This is what we do in the pastry shop, long slender pieces of chocolate are rolled into the unbaked dough, then baked. Now - if you really want to put pastry cream into a croissant ( and it sound great ! ) -- bake the croissant first, - then pipe the filling into the croissant. You can visit a baking store, and pick up a piping tip specifically for this purpose. This is how I would do it.
